*、面向对象
官方一点就是封装(隐藏属性)继承(复用)多态(子类对象赋值给父类变量但依然可以运行出子类特征,重载重写),简单来说就是以对象为中心进行思维的展开 eg: 面向过程的思维:吃(猪八戒,西瓜); 面向对象的思维:猪八戒.吃(西瓜); 将过程中的执行者变成了指挥者
*、面向对象的软件开发的三个阶段
OOA(面向对象分析) OOD(面向对象设计) OOP(面向对象编程)
*、代码编写四步骤
1、明确需求,我要做什么? 2、分析思路,我要怎么做? 3、确定步骤,具体到方法、语句以及对象的结构。 4、代码实现,用具体的java代码实现。
*、学习新技术的四点
1、该技术是什么,干嘛的? 2、该技术的特点(使用注意)? 3、该技术如何用,demo? 4、该技术什么时候适合用,test?
*、java的三种技术架构
javame手机端 javase桌面程序 javaee企业web端
*、jdk与jre
jdk>=jre
*、javac与java
javac编译成class文件,java运行class文件
*、关键字和保留字
关键字:赋予了特殊意义 保留字:未赋予但将来准备赋予
*、java共分五片内存
1、寄存器; 2、本地方法区; 3、方法区; 4、栈(短); 5、堆(长)
*、设计模式
代表一种思想或解决方案。 eg: 单例模式的饱汉式(直接创建)和饿汉式(用时再创建)
*、Hiberante,iBatis,MyBatis都是对数据访问的封装
Hiberante,iBatis,MyBatis都是对数据访问的封装
相关推荐
### JAVA基础入门教程知识点梳理 #### 一、Java语言简介 **1.1 Java的历史与发展** Java语言起源于Sun Microsystems公司的Green项目,最初的目的是为了开发一套适用于家用电器的分布式代码系统,以便实现设备间的...
### Java基础入门教程知识点梳理 #### 一、Java概述 1. **定义**: - Java是一种计算机编程语言。 - Java是一种软件开发平台。 - Java是一种软件运行平台。 - Java是一种软件部署环境。 2. **作为编程语言**...
根据提供的文件信息,以下是关于Java基础教程的知识点梳理: 1. Java语言的起源与发展:Java语言是由Sun Microsystems公司于1995年发布的,由James Gosling领导的小组开发。Java语言的早期代号为“Oak”,后来被...
### Java语言基础入门教程知识点梳理 #### 一、Java编程入门概述 - **课程目标**: - 介绍Java程序开发及其运行环境。 - 通过`HelloWorld`示例程序讲解基本概念。 - 讲解开发工具的使用。 #### 二、Java程序...
其中,“JAVA零基础入门教程笔记-任小龙”很可能是PDF或者文档形式的教程,详细讲解了Java的基础概念和语法。 Java的学习通常从以下几个方面展开: 1. **Java环境搭建**:首先,你需要安装Java Development Kit ...
3. **跨平台特性**:Java 最大的特点之一是其跨平台性,这得益于 JVM(Java 虚拟机)的存在,使得编写的 Java 程序可以在任何支持 JVM 的平台上运行。 ### 二、Java 的三大版本 1. **标准版 (Java SE)**:适用于...
通过以上对Java基础知识的学习要点梳理,初学者能够建立起对Java语言的整体认知,并为进一步深入学习打下坚实的基础。值得注意的是,实践是检验真理的唯一标准,只有不断动手编程练习,才能真正掌握所学知识。希望每...
通过上述知识点的梳理,我们可以看到《Java菜鸟入门手册》涵盖了Java编程语言的基础知识、面向对象编程的核心概念、网络编程的技术要点以及Java Web开发的实际案例。这些内容不仅适合Java初学者作为入门指南,也为...
### Java学习入门资料知识点梳理 #### 一、Java语言历史与发展 - **起源与早期发展** - **前身**:Oak(1990年),由James Gosling等人在Sun Microsystems开发。 - **Green项目**:Sun Microsystems于1990年开始...
### Java从入门到精通知识点梳理 #### 一、Java核心概念 **1. 环境搭建** - **Java的历史**: Java由Sun Microsystems公司在1995年发布。 - **发展方向**: 包括JAVASE(Java Standard Edition,标准版)、JAVAME...
### Java经典入门教程知识点梳理 #### 一、Java的基础概念 **1.1 Java的定义** - **语言**: Java是一种计算机编程语言,用于与计算机进行交流。它具有特定的语法规则,使得人类可以通过它向计算机发出指令。 - **...
通过以上知识点的梳理,可以看出“Java开发从入门到骨灰”这一教程旨在为初学者提供一个完整的学习路径,从基本语法到高级特性,再到实战项目开发,帮助学习者逐步建立起扎实的Java编程能力。无论是对初学者还是有...
### Java学习入门资料知识点梳理 #### 一、Java的历史与发展 - **前身**: Java 的前身是 OAK,由 James Gosling 在 1990 年于 Sun 公司开发。 - **Green 工程**: 1990 年,Sun 公司启动 Green 工程。 - **互联网...
JAVA核心基础梳理一(入门)
快速掌握Java基础知识,快速帮助小白Java入门,零基础的小白也适用。本文档仅仅基础一部分,包括Hello代码详解,细节,格式,注释;path的作用;Java的跨平台特性图;标识符;关键字;变量;数据类型划分和基本数据...
通过以上知识点的梳理,我们可以看到Java语言的基础部分涵盖了数据类型、变量声明与初始化、基本类型的使用等多个方面。掌握这些基础知识对于初学者来说至关重要,也是后续深入学习Java编程的基础。
很抱歉,您提供的文件信息并不包含足够的内容来生成相关的知识点。【标题】、【描述】和【标签】都仅仅提供了关于该文件的基本信息,...如果您能提供具体的章节内容或者详细描述,我将非常乐意帮助您梳理和总结知识点。